House Panel Backs Waxman as Energy Chairman PDF Print E-mail

Rep. Henry Waxman of California narrowly won a preliminary contest on Wednesday to replace Rep. John Dingell of Michigan as chairman of the U.S. House of Representatives Energy and Commerce Committee.

Dingell has fought for decades for breaks for the Big Three automakers, including pushing to weaken the Clean Air Act during the Reagan administration. Waxman has long battled for clean air and water legislation and to curb climate change, one of President-elect Barack Obama's top goals.
